How To Access Blocked Websites?
Posted By Keith Dsouza On February 14, 2009 @ 3:45 pm In Featured Articles | 5 Comments
There are several times when websites may be blocked in your school, college or at work, though that is not the end of the world, and you would still be able to access the websites by using a proxy website which uses a different IP address than the one directly used by your computer.
This in turn helps bypass your administrator’s block on the actual websites like Twitter [1], Facebook, Orkut and so on.
